Subject: – Teaching of Sanskrit in Kendriya Vidyalaya in Classes XI and XII.
Article 108 of KVS Education Code stipulating the Scheme of Studies for various classes has a provision for study of Sanskrit or’Hindi or English as Compulsory Core language for classes XI and XII. In this regard, the decision taken in the 99th Meeting of the Board of Governors of KVS held on 27-10-2014 is conveyed as under:
The Board approved the proposal to offer teaching of Sanskrit language in Class XI from the session 2015-16 in all the Kendriya Vidyalayas having Senior Secondary classes. Sanskrit (Core) will be offered as one of the options in lieu of an elective subject. For this teachers may be appointed initially on contract basis.
